Action item from the Shopline catalog incident: plugin authors relying on the Varnet catalog cache must not assume invalidation happens within one minute of a product update. During the outage, stale entries persisted for up to four hours because purge events were dropped silently. We now emit explicit invalidation notices that plugins can subscribe to. Full details on the new invalidation contract are documented on the internal page below.

operations page: https://vault.qorvelcorp.example/settings

# Spokewise rebalancer — support env file.
# Controls the van-dispatch tool that moves bikes between docks overnight.
# REBALANCE_WINDOW sets the run hours; DOCK_THRESHOLD sets the trigger fill level.
# Don't edit during an active run — dispatchers in the Harlow depot get paged.
# Restart the worker after any change. The dispatch API requires a credential, set on the next line:

sealed setting: RELAY_SECRET13=bca49b02a6971

A: As of release 14, Ledgerwing exports payroll batches in a versioned columnar format rather than the legacy flat CSV. Field names are now lowercase, amounts are in minor units, and the header row includes a schema version your plugin must check before parsing. Plugins that assumed fixed column positions will fail validation. We strongly recommend migrating before the legacy format is retired next quarter. The full field mapping, migration examples, and deprecation timeline are published on the internal page below.

wiki page, bagaf-fawip: https://harbor.tolvaqsys.local/pages/repo/pages/secrets/eac969ffc71f356b